Meet the Drivers: Sonny Hayes and Joshua Pearce

The film centers on the fictional APX GP team, with its two main drivers embodying different eras and styles of Formula 1 racing. Their on-screen personas are heavily influenced by the clothes they wear, both in and out of the cockpit.

  • Brad Pitt as Sonny Hayes: A seasoned, older F1 driver who comes out of retirement to mentor a young talent. His look balances classic racing grit with a timeless, cool aesthetic.
  • Damson Idris as Joshua Pearce: The young, rising star of the APX GP team. His wardrobe is modern, bold, and reflects the current generation of F1 drivers who are also fashion icons.
  • The Team: APX GP (Apex Grand Prix) is the fictional 11th team on the F1 grid, designed to look and feel like a genuine, high-budget racing operation.
  • Director: Joseph Kosinski (known for Top Gun: Maverick).
  • Producer: Jerry Bruckheimer and seven-time F1 champion Lewis Hamilton.
  • Costume Designer: Julian Day (known for Bohemian Rhapsody and Rocketman).

The APX GP Racing Uniform: Authenticity on the Grid

The most crucial element of the film's wardrobe is the official APX GP racing suit, which had to be fully authentic to pass muster with both the F1 community and the film's technical advisors. Costume Designer Julian Day faced the challenge of creating a fictional team that could convincingly stand alongside real teams like Mercedes, Ferrari, and Red Bull.

The Race Suit Design: White, Black, and Bold Branding

The APX GP race suits worn by Brad Pitt and Damson Idris are instantly recognizable. The core design features a striking combination of white and black, with contrasting color panels that give the uniform a modern, professional, and race-ready aesthetic. The suits are not mere costumes; they are authentic-looking replicas that mirror the gear worn by real F1 drivers.

  • Color Scheme: Predominantly white with black accents and contrasting panels, giving a clean, high-tech look.
  • Sponsor Logos: The suits are covered in bold sponsor branding and striking APX GP logos, mimicking the visual complexity of genuine F1 attire.
  • Construction: The material used for the fan replicas is often a high-grade, glossy nylon Cordura fabric with a cotton-towel lining, suggesting the on-screen versions are designed for maximum visual impact and believability under race conditions.
  • The Pit Crew: To maintain the high level of immersion, the APX GP pit crew also wears race-ready uniforms, ensuring that every detail in the pit lane is authentic to the world of Formula 1.

The creation of the APX GP look was a holistic process, with Julian Day and his team developing the entire visual identity—from the car livery and team apparel to the drivers' personal style—from the ground up. This commitment to detail is what sets the film's aesthetic apart.

Off-Track Style: From Paddock to Podium Fashion

An F1 driver's life is not just about the racetrack; the paddock is a runway where high-end fashion and sportswear collide. The casual and formal outfits worn by Sonny Hayes and Joshua Pearce reflect their personalities, their status, and the multi-million dollar world they inhabit. The wardrobe seamlessly transitions from the high-octane environment of the garage to the glamour of the hospitality suites.

Sonny Hayes (Brad Pitt): The Veteran’s Timeless Cool

Brad Pitt's character, Sonny Hayes, embodies a relaxed yet sophisticated style, fitting for a driver who has seen it all. His outfits are often classic pieces updated with a modern, sporty edge.

  • The Bomber Jacket: A key piece in his off-track wardrobe is a classic bomber jacket, a staple of motorsport casual wear.
  • The Striped Shirt: Pitt has been seen in a multi-color striped short-sleeve shirt, blending classic and modern styles for a relaxed paddock look.
  • Off-White Shirt: A soft, stylish off-white shirt is another staple, perfect for everyday wear while maintaining a celebrity-inspired, clean aesthetic.
  • The Jumpsuit: Beyond the official race suit, a white racer jumpsuit is featured, serving as a sophisticated sports outfit that is also comfortable and stylish for casual track-side life.

Joshua Pearce (Damson Idris): The Rising Star’s Modern Edge

Damson Idris's character, Joshua Pearce, represents the younger, more fashion-forward generation of F1 stars. His style is sleek, contemporary, and often features pieces from major fashion collaborations.

  • Tommy Hilfiger Collaboration: A significant part of the APX GP off-track look comes from a collaboration with Tommy Hilfiger, a brand with a long history in F1. Idris mentioned that the pieces worn by his character, Joshua Pearce, are sleek and easy to move in, reflecting his own personal style and the demands of track life.
  • Orange Quilted Bomber: One notable piece is an orange quilted bomber jacket, which adds a pop of color and a modern, athletic feel to his look, fitting for a rising star.
  • Designer Eyewear: His off-track identity is also defined by his choice of eyewear, with a focus on sophisticated sunglasses that complete the high-fashion, celebrity-driver persona.
